The following is an index to property transfer deeds and easements recorded at the Suffolk County Deed Registry from the original land purchase through December 31, 2020. Mortgages, trust agreements, and other similar recorded documents are not included. This index is intended as a guide only; actual deeds should be reviewed for details.
Transfers of Land and Buildings | |||||||
Date of Deed | Grantor | Grantee | Book | Page | |||
07Aug2013 | Eric Dluhosch | XINQIAO (USA) Corporation | 52183 | 27 | |||
29Aug1975 | Bernard P. Rome, trustee in bankruptcy under Article II of the Plan of Arrangement of Chamberlayne School and Chamberlayne Junior College in Chapter XI Proceedings | Eric Dluhosch and Katalin Dluhosch, husband and wife | 8817 | 601 | |||
16Jun1975 | Chamberlayne School and Chamberlayne Junior College | Bernard P. Rome, trustee in bankruptcy under Article II of the Plan of Arrangement of Chamberlayne School and Chamberlayne Junior College in Chapter XI Proceedings | 8817 | 600 | |||
11Aug1964 | Sylvia L. Norris, trustee, The Allen Borden Realty Trust | Chamberlayne School and Chamberlayne Junior College | 7874 | 122 | |||
22Jun1964 | Paul J. Zirkle and Patricia M. Zirkle, husband and wife | Sylvia L. Norris, trustee, The Allen Borden Realty Trust | 7857 | 317 | |||
27Nov1961 | Irma Grossman and Miriam Brower | Paul J. Zirkle and Patricia M. Zirkle, husband and wife | 7608 | 183 | |||
29Jun1961 | Harry Stark | Irma Grossman and Miriam Brower | 7568 | 302 | |||
10Dec1958 | Henry H. Davis and Virginia N. Davis, husband and wife | Harry Stark | 7361 | 391 | |||
18Aug1958 | Frank L. Rumney | Henry H. Davis and Virginia N. Davis, husband and wife | 7335 | 148 | |||
15Apr1942 | Annie Hardy | Frank L. Rumney | 5980 | 88 | |||
21Oct1940 | Mary C. Hollingsworth | Annie Hardy | 5885 | 471 | |||
29Aug1899 | Susan J. Hollingsworth, mother and heir of Sumner Hollingsworth; Ellis Hollingsworth, brother and heir of Sumner Hollingsworth; and Elsie M. Hollingsworth, wife of Ellis Hollingsworth | Mary C. Hollingsworth, widow of Sumner Hollingsworth | 2631 | 332 | |||
01Jul1887 | Augustus L. Soule | Sumner Hollingsworth | 1779 | 489 | |||
23Apr1883 | George W. Simmons | Augustus L. Soule | 1594 | 335 | |||
29May1871 | Henry C. Wainwright (lot with 52.12 foot frontage on Fairfield and dwelling house) | George W. Simmons, Jr. | 1051 | 305 | |||
Transfers of Unimproved Land | |||||||
Date of Deed | Grantor | Grantee | Book | Page | |||
19Nov1870 | J. Templeman Coolidge, Franklin Evans, and Charles Henry Parker, trustees (lot with 36 foot frontage on Marlborough) | Henry C. Wainwright | 1024 | 284 | |||
07Oct1870 | Thomas J. Homer, Warren Emerson, J. Homer Pierce, and William Homer, trustees under the will of Sidney Homer (lot with 30 foot frontage on Marlborough and 112 foot frontage on Fairfield) | Henry C. Wainwright | 1024 | 282 | |||
12Apr1866 (recorded 25Nov1870) | J. Templeman Coolidge, Franklin Evans, and Charles Henry Parker, trustees (lot with 30 foot frontage on Marlborough and 112 foot frontage on Fairfield) | Sidney Homer | 1024 | 281 | |||
29Jan1866 | Boston Water Power Company | J. Templeman Coolidge, Franklin Evans, and Charles Henry Parker, trustees | 871 | 183 | |||
